How is Upper Eyelid Blepharoplasty performed?

EyeLift-3DTM procedures begin with meticulous surgical planning, involving meticulous measurements and markings. Laser incisions are used to remove precise amounts of excess eyelid skin. However, we understand that optimal results require more than just addressing the superficial layers. We also focus on deeper structures, such as reducing excess orbital fat and repositioning descended glands. The final step involves addressing the surrounding skin that will remain after surgery. This is accomplished through the use of lasers and energy-based devices to tighten and resurface the skin, providing a refined finishing touch.

Asian Blepharoplasty - Double Eyelid Surgery

Asian Blepharoplasty, commonly known as double eyelid surgery, is a procedure to createa defined crease in the upper eyelid. The goal is often to achieve a double eyelid, a featurethat is considered aesthetically desirable in many cultures. Asian Blepharoplasty is highlyindividualized, considering factors like the patient's unique eye anatomy, desired creaseheight, and overall facial harmony. Dr. Denton uses both the incisional method andnon-incisional suture method, depending on the client preferences and anatomicalconsiderations. While the goal is a double fold, there are many other aspects of thisprocedure that dier from blepharoplasty in our clients from other ethnic backgrounds.

How long does upper eyelid surgery take?

Upper Eyelid Surgery takes 60-75 minutes.

What type of anesthetic is required for upper eyelid blepharoplasty?

Most of our clients choose oral sedation and local anesthetic for upper eyelid surgery. A smaller percent choose to have the procedure performed under general anesthesia (aka asleep).

How long is the downtime after Eyelid surgery?

Variable degrees of bruising and swelling can occur for 2-3 weeks after surgery. Expect continued improvement for up to six months, with incisions fading in 9-12 months. Incisions are discreetly placed at the eyelid crease, which naturally conceals the healing process once the initial swelling and bruising subside.

How long will the results of Upper Eyelid Blepharoplasty last?

Blepharoplasty provides enduring results and is a surgery that is only required only once for most individuals. A smaller percentage of people require a second blepharoplasty 10-20 years after their first procedure.

Can Upper Eyelid Blepharoplasty correct asymmetry between the two eyelids?

Many eyelid asymmetries can be corrected with Upper Eyelid Blepharoplasty, while some cannot be corrected due to individual anatomy or issues like uneven brow descent as the source of asymmetry.

Is eyelid heaviness only due to excess skin?

Brow descent can also contribute. Eyelid surgery alone may not fully address heaviness in such cases, necessitating a brow lift.
